2025: MINISTER OF WOMEN AFFAIRS, HAJIYA IMAAN SULAIMAN-IBRAHIM FELICITATES NIGERIAN WOMEN, GIRLS ON NATIONAL WORKERS’ DAY


The Honourable Minister of Women Affairs, Hajiya Imaan Sulaiman-Ibrahim, has extended heartfelt congratulations to Nigerian women, girls, and the entire workforce as the nation commemorates the 2025 International Workers’ Day.

The Minister expressed deep appreciation for the dedication, resilience, and commitment of workers across all sectors—particularly staff of the Federal Ministry of Women Affairs—for their invaluable contributions to national development.

“I celebrate your hard work, commitment, and contributions to various sectors. Your tireless efforts have built a stronger, more resilient Nigeria. From healthcare and education to entrepreneurship and public service, your work continues to improve lives and shape our nation’s future.”

Commending the Ministry’s team specifically, the Minister said: â€śTo our Ministry’s staff, I commend your passion and dedication to promoting women’s empowerment and protecting their rights. Your work has made a lasting impact on the lives of Nigerian women and girls.”

Reaffirming alignment with the Renewed Hope Agenda of President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u, GCFR, the Minister emphasized the administration’s continued commitment to advancing workers’ welfare, ensuring safe and inclusive work environments, and fostering dignity and equity in the workplace.

“Together, we can build a brighter, more equitable future for all Nigerians.”

As part of the celebration, the Minister wished all Nigerian workers good health, fulfillment, and recognition for their efforts: â€śMay your labour be fruitful, and may your efforts be recognized and rewarded.”
